1993.) The
STORYs moved to Tillsonburg in 1961. Ed was a retired
tobacco executive from Canadian Leaf Tobacco Co. (Chatham and
Tillsonburg) and
RJR MacDonald Tobacco Co. (Tillsonburg, Kingsville
and Toronto). In 1984, he went on to become the first and only
president and Chief Executive Officer of Canagrex (a Canadian
Federal Crown Corporation) set up in Ottawa to export agriculture
products. After its demise, he continued in management and export
consulting. In 1991, he became part owner, President and Chief
Executive Officer of Recreation and Industrial Products Corp.,
Tillsonburg, retiring in 1996. Ed was a Councilor, Town of Tillsonburg,
from 1978 to 1980, a life-long member of Kent Lodge 274 Ancient,
Free and Accepted Masons, Blenheim, Ontario, a member of Saint Paul's
United Church, Tillsonburg, a private pilot and past President
of The Tillsonburg Flying Club, as well as an avid trapshooter
and member of The Otter Valley Rod and Gun Club and The Oxford
Sportsman's Club. Donations gratefully appreciated (by cheque
